“When I am feeling bad about myself, the best thing I can do is spend time with someone who knows me well and loves me well. Out of all the people in my life who fit that description, nobody can come close to the way my Heavenly Father knows me and loves me. He has known me, and you, since before the world was created.”

“So pray with all your heart. Pray for the ability to forgive. Pray for the person who hurt you. Pray to be filled with the love of Christ. And the Lord will fill your well of charity until it overflows. Even if all you have is the desire to forgive the person who hurt you, it is enough to take to the Lord. If you will bring Him the desire, the Lord will provide the miracle of forgiveness.”

“Anger will eat at the most tender parts of your heart and make you hard-hearted, bitter, and jaded. A hard heart cannot feel the gentle touch of the Holy Ghost. A bitter heart cannot taste the sweetness of forgiveness. A jaded heart cannot believe in Christ's power to heal all wounds.”
